REXBURG, Idaho Work progresses on the new Rexburg Idaho Temple, with the placing of the statue of the Angel Moroni on the spire on a rainy Sept. 21. The temple, to serve Church members in the Upper Snake River Valley, including students at BYU-Idaho, was announced Dec. 12, 2003. Ground was broken by Elder John H. Groberg, then of the Presidency of the Seventy on July 30, 2005. A specific completion date has not been announced, but considerable interior work remains.
